The Programme
01
Structured Phasing
Rehabilitation is planned from day one around the surgical outcome and the operating vet's guidance. Each phase has defined objectives and progression criteria. No phase advances until the horse is ready — the horse sets the timeline, not a fixed schedule.
02
Professional Coordination
Kate works directly with the operating vet, farrier, physiotherapist and chiropractor throughout. All interventions are coordinated, timed to support recovery, and documented. One point of contact for the owner, managing the whole professional network.
03
Full Documentation
Every session, observation and treatment is recorded contemporaneously. Body condition and posture are photographed over time. The leaving pack is a complete medical and rehabilitation record — available for inspection and handed to the new keeper on departure.
Why This Is Different
"Surgical rehabilitation requires more than rest. It requires a handler who reads the horse accurately, adjusts the programme when the horse says to, and knows when to call the vet."
Kate is BHS qualified and an RoR Approved Retrainer with a case history that includes SDFT tendon lesion rehabilitation, kissing spine management, navicular, post-operative back surgery, and second-chance cases where earlier management had failed. Cases are accepted by referral following consultation with the operating or treating vet. Current post-operative surgical case in active rehabilitation at the yard. Throughput direct from Flat and Jump Yards for retraining, with a history of successful development into other competition careers including: Polo, Point to Point, Endurance, Eventing and Riding Club.
